In the bustling city of Delhi, India, a silent tragedy unfolds every day that often goes unnoticed - the fatigue experienced by countless women as they navigate through the challenges and demands of their daily lives. From juggling household responsibilities to fulfilling work obligations, women in Delhi often find themselves overwhelmed and exhausted, with little time or energy left for self-care and personal well-being. The relentless pace of life in Delhi, with its congested streets, long commutes, and busy work schedules, takes a toll on women who are expected to seamlessly balance their professional and personal lives. The pressure to meet societal expectations of being the perfect wife, mother, and daughter only adds to their burden, leaving many women feeling drained and depleted. Furthermore, the prevalence of gender inequality and patriarchy in Indian society further exacerbates women's fatigue in Delhi. The lack of support systems and resources for women, coupled with the constant fear of harassment and violence, creates a challenging environment that contributes to their physical and emotional exhaustion. In addition, the stigma surrounding mental health issues in India often prevents women from seeking help or talking openly about their struggles, leading to feelings of isolation and helplessness. The widespread prevalence of stress, anxiety, and depression among women in Delhi highlights the urgent need for more awareness and support for mental health issues.
